📰 What Happened

The US has warned Iran about potential assassination threats to its negotiators from Israel. This warning reflects the heightened tensions and risks involved in the ongoing negotiations between Iran and other powers.

  • The US is concerned about the safety of Iranian negotiators amidst sensitive discussions.
  • Israel has previously targeted Iranian officials, raising fears of further escalations.

📚 Background

Iran and Israel have a long history of conflict, particularly over Iran's nuclear program, which Israel perceives as an existential threat. The US has often acted as a mediator in these tensions.
